A mother is concerned because her daughter woke up with a slight fever and a runny nose, and considers giving the child some children's aspirin to reduce the fever. Before she does this, she calls the pediatrician to ask for advice . Explain the mechanism of the fever and the benefits of a fever in fighting infections. What happens when the mother gives the aspirin to the child?

It turns out that giving aspirin to children during a viral illness—most often influenza (the flu) or chickenpox—can lead to a potentially fatal condition called Reye's syndrome. 1 Reye's is defined by sudden brain damage and liver function problems. It can cause seizures, coma, and death
